There’s some unfortunate but not all that surprising news to share about the 2020 ESSENCE Festival of Culture. Organizers have confirmed that the festival set to be headlined by Janet Jackson and Bruno Mars will not take place this year. ESSENCE originally announced a fall postponement for the Independence Day weekend fest, now the festival will return in July 2021.
